Lena: Miles, I just tried something wild this morning - I spent five minutes visualizing my presentation going perfectly, and I swear I felt more confident before I even got to the office. Is there actually something to this whole "mind over reality" thing?
Miles: You know what's fascinating? You just stumbled onto what neuroscientists call "functional equivalence." When you vividly imagine doing something, your brain literally fires the same neural pathways as if you were actually doing it. It's why Olympic athletes mentally rehearse their routines - their brains can't tell the difference between a perfect mental performance and a real one.
Lena: Wait, so my brain thought I already nailed that presentation? That's incredible! But I'm curious - if visualization is that powerful for confidence, what about bigger goals? Can you actually manifest money or influence people just by picturing it clearly?
